Subject: Planner regression — read before your first shift

Heads up. Quillmark 4.2 introduced a query planner regression: certain joins on the ledger tables pick a sequential scan and blow the latency budget. Rollback is not an option mid-cycle. Mitigation: the planner hint patch is live; if alerts fire anyway, pin affected queries per the workaround doc. Don't improvise. Page Renna only if the hint patch itself fails. Full triage steps are on the internal page here:

operations page: https://confluence.qorvellabs.internal/pages/projects/projects/projects

## Ownership

The file `lintbase.yaml` is the static-analysis baseline for Quarrel CI. Do not regenerate it casually: new warnings should be fixed, not baselined. Regeneration is allowed only after a toolchain upgrade, and the diff must be reviewed. Questions, exceptions, and regeneration approvals go through the baseline owner named below.

account owner for bawip-tahag: Raleth Quenok

**Ticket #: Vault locked after image-slimming rollout — Ostrel Build Team**

While trimming the base image for the Calverno deploy pipeline, we removed the vault client's helper binaries, which caused three failed unseal attempts and locked the secrets vault. Functionality is restored in the slimmed image, but the vault remains locked pending manual recovery. Per policy, a reviewer must confirm the lockout cause before unsealing. To proceed, unseal with the passphrase provided below.

unlock words, bahap-bajof: sorax-giliel-quenwyn

- [ ] Step 7: Archive cold storage buckets (Glacierline tier). Confirm both ceremony witnesses are present, verify bucket manifests match the Oxbow ledger, then seal the archive key shares. Plugin authors may observe but not handle shares. Once sealed, the archive index itself is encrypted and can only be reopened with the passphrase below.

vault phrase of badup-hahig = tamael-aldael-kelmir-istael-fenok-istwyn-tamius-jorath-oliion